I LOVE this place and strongly recommend it!!!!. I have been absolutely thrilled with the Dinner A'Fare at Northlake. The facility is new and spotless, and the staff is incredible. They are extremely helpful and always go out of their way to make the experience go smoothly. They are a caring and friendly group who really want to help make life easier. The meal choices are varied and very healthful. I love the fact that they even list "Diet points" for those on Weight Watchers. Overall, I feel that since going to the Dinner A'Fare at Northlake, I am eating a more healthy well-rounded diet that has a great variety. Also, I have found the program to be very cost effective, especially with the twelve meal pack. I have compared costs for some of my favorite meals that I would make at home and the Dinner A'Fare is comparable or even cheaper many times. Most importantly I find that I am saving time by going there, and this makes life much easier.

Easy dinner option!. My husband and I decided to try out Dinner A'fare after hearing a lot of buzz about the concept. We're both really busy people--he's in graduate school, about to graduate, and I'm an attorney who recently went back to school. In a little less than two hours, we had created 12 meals that serve "5-6" according to the website. Our hope was to have enough for two nights of dinner, plus leftovers for lunch. That's exactly how it worked out! All of the dishes are super-easy to prepare at home--only requiring a few minutes of microwaving, or putting them in the oven, or cooking pasta. Way easy, and no more than 30 minutes from fridge to freezer. The only negative we've run into is that we keep forgetting to take the dinners out of the freezer to let them thaw the night before. (Not their fault...just a result of being busy and not thinking ahead!) We're about to sign up for our second session this week. I love not having to clean up, do prep work, etc...and I also love being able to customize the ingredients to what we like our food to taste like. Enjoy!
